Recently, the Flutter tool was updated to remove dev dependencies for release builds and add dev dependencies for debug/profile builds. However when building from Xcode directly, dev dependencies are not enabled/disabled. As a result, it was possible for debug builds to not have dev dependencies (or vice versa). Example: 1. `flutter build ios --release` - Release build using Flutter tool. Disables dev dependencies 2. `open ios/Runner.xcworkspace` - Open the iOS project in Xcode 3. In Xcode, **Product** > **Build** - Do a debug build Previously, step 3 would result in debug artifacts that are missing dev dependencies. This PR now makes this an error:  Part of https://github.com/flutter/flutter/issues/163874 ## Implementation The Flutter tool now writes a `FLUTTER_DEV_DEPENDENCIES_ENABLED` in the generated config file. This tracks whether the currently generated project has dev dependencies. In the Xcode build: 1. The Xcode backend script passes the `FLUTTER_DEV_DEPENDENCIES_ENABLED` config to `flutter assemble` using the `DevDependenciesEnabled` define 6. The new `CheckDevDependencies` target verifies dev dependencies: 1. It checks if the dev dependencies status is correct for the current build mode 2. It checks whether the app has dev dependencies by reading the `.flutter-plugins-dependencies` file. This directory contains tools and resources that the Flutter team uses during the development of the framework. The tools in this directory should not be necessary for developing Flutter applications, though of course, they may be interesting if you are curious.
